Let us get to the heart of the parable.

 

  1. The sheepfold is a picture of the Church of God.
  1. It was a separated place for the sheep to be taken in the hours of darkness. All round us today is darkness. 1 Peter 2:9. 1 Tim 3:15.
  2. It was a place of protection from danger. Out of the darkness comes danger. Col 1:13. “Who hath delivered us from the power of darkness, and hath translated us into the kingdom of his dear Son.”

C. I am sure that there were lights in the sheepfold. Shepherds would need light to watch out for predators and also the welfare of the sheep. John 12:46. Psalm 89:15 – called into the light by the ‘joyful sound’ of the gospel!
